Dubai-based low-cost carrier flydubai has announced that it will become the first airline to offer flights between the United Arab Emirates (UAE) and the islands of Penang and Langkawi in Malaysia. The flights, on a Boeing 737 MAX aircraft, are scheduled to start from 10th February 2024 and will directly connect Dubai with Penang. The flights offered by flydubai will also provide the option for a further connection from Penang to Langkawi, a popular coastal destination. The carrier aims to offer convenient travel options to passengers from the UAE, the Gulf Cooperation Council (GCC) and the European markets, who are looking for leisure and business opportunities in Malaysia. The country continues to be a much-loved tourist destination with its rich history, cultural diversity, natural beauty, modern marvels and gastronomic delights and these new flights will open up new discoveries and adventures.
